How to create a budget for your startup
Creating a budget for your startup is crucial to its success. It allows you to plan and prioritize your expenses, allocate resources effectively, and make informed financial decisions. Here are some tips on how to create a solid budget for your startup:
- Estimate your revenue: Start by estimating the amount of revenue you expect to generate in the upcoming months or year. This will give you an idea of how much money you have available to work with.
- Identify fixed costs: These are expenses that remain constant regardless of sales volume, such as rent, utilities, insurance premiums etc.
- Determine variable costs: Variable costs change based on sales volume or production output like materials cost and marketing expense.
- Set realistic goals: Make sure that your projections are achievable and supportable by conducting research about market trends and competitor analysis.
- Track actuals vs planned expenses – Reviewing actual results against budgets provides useful insights into operations performance
- Prepare multiple scenarios- The better-prepared one is when it comes time for action planning; the more likely they can achieve their business objectives
By following these steps, you’ll be able to create a budget that aligns with your company’s goals while ensuring financial stability in the long run
Tips for sticking to your budget
Sticking to a budget is easier said than done, especially for startups. However, proper budgeting is crucial for the success of your business. Here are some tips to help you stick to your startup’s budget:
- Prioritize your spending: Make sure that funds are being used on essentials first before splurging on unnecessary expenses.
- Keep track of every expense: It’s important to keep an accurate record of all financial transactions and review them regularly.
- Set realistic goals: Establish realistic targets in order to keep yourself accountable and motivated towards achieving financial stability.
- Avoid impulsive purchases: Urgent or unplanned expenses can quickly add up and throw off your entire budget plan.
- Use technology to assist you: There are many online tools available that can help monitor finances as well as automate certain tasks such as payment reminders.
By following these tips, startups can effectively manage their budgets and stay on track towards long-term success without sacrificing any essential spending needs or growth opportunities
